Subaru of Spartanburg opens updated dealership under new ownership
Subaru of Spartanburg marked the grand opening of its expanded facility on Aug. 13 in Spartanburg, S.C., after transitioning from Vic Bailey Subaru under new ownership. The event highlights a modernization effort built around customer experience while preserving the dealership’s more than 50-year presence in the Upstate.
Why it matters: - Subaru of Spartanburg is trying to pair a refreshed retail experience with a long local legacy in Spartanburg. - The dealership’s reopening underscores continued investment in the Upstate auto market and the customer experience. - The move also signals how Hudson Automotive Group is expanding its footprint while keeping community ties visible.
What happened: - Subaru of Spartanburg held a grand opening on Aug. 13 for its newly updated and expanded dealership in Spartanburg, S.C. - The event welcomed customers, community members, local leaders and partners. - The dealership opened its new chapter after transitioning from Vic Bailey Subaru to Subaru of Spartanburg under new ownership. - The dealership has served the Spartanburg area since 1969.
The details: - General Manager Heath McPherson said the reopening was about honoring the dealership’s history while building its future. - The grand opening included a ribbon-cutting ceremony, food and beverages, giveaways and a scavenger hunt. - Attendees also saw vehicle displays, a Subaru Motorsports car and appearances by Subie Squatch. - The event gave guests a chance to tour the new facility and meet the Subaru of Spartanburg team. - Subaru of Spartanburg highlighted support for the Spartanburg Humane Society as part of its local community involvement. - Subaru of Spartanburg is part of Hudson Automotive Group, a third-generation, family-owned auto group. - Hudson Automotive Group was founded in 1948 and now has more than 60 dealerships and more than 4,000 employees across seven states. - Subaru of Spartanburg was recognized as a J.D. Power 2024 Dealer of Excellence for Customer Sales Experience, an honor awarded to Spartanburg Imports. - The dealership now offers new, pre-owned and Certified Pre-Owned vehicles, certified service, financing and a complimentary Exclusive Lifetime Warranty on new Subaru vehicles.
